Mériem Er-Rafik is a scholar working on Biomaterials, Molecular Biology and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Mériem Er-Rafik has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 600 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Biomaterials, 7 papers in Molecular Biology and 5 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Mériem Er-Rafik's work include Nanoparticle-Based Drug Delivery (4 papers), Lipid Membrane Structure and Behavior (3 papers) and Advanced Polymer Synthesis and Characterization (3 papers). Mériem Er-Rafik is often cited by papers focused on Nanoparticle-Based Drug Delivery (4 papers), Lipid Membrane Structure and Behavior (3 papers) and Advanced Polymer Synthesis and Characterization (3 papers). Mériem Er-Rafik collaborates with scholars based in France, Germany and Egypt. Mériem Er-Rafik's co-authors include Marc Schmutz, Martin Möller, Fatma Briki, J. Doucet, Amina L. Mohamed, Fábio Fernandes, Olivier Sandre, Tan Phat Dao, Jean‐François Le Meins and Manuel Prieto and has published in prestigious journals such as Macromolecules, Langmuir and Biophysical Journal.
